Output 10e825124d3db18093bdd6e3304992859d0f4861f4eaeb9961210e1ca76f60df:156

value
24963
script pubkey
OP_0 OP_PUSHBYTES_20 ef2554b5682e202bee1c27f93ba5703fac245aab
address
bc1qauj4fdtg9cszhmsuylunhfts87kzgk4tswrxq4
transaction
10e825124d3db18093bdd6e3304992859d0f4861f4eaeb9961210e1ca76f60df